Saving energy and reducing consumption
The energy saving of injection molding machine can be divided into two parts: one is the power part, the other is the heating part.
Energy saving in the power part: inverter is mostly used, and energy saving is achieved by saving the residual energy consumption of the motor. For example, the actual power of the motor is 50Hz, but you actually only need 30Hz in the production, and those excess energy consumption will be wasted. Inverter is to change the power output of the motor to achieve the effect of energy saving.
Heating part energy saving: heating part energy saving is mostly the use of electromagnetic heater energy saving, energy saving rate is about 30%-70% of the old resistance ring
1.Compared with resistance heating, electromagnetic heater has a layer of insulation layer, and the utilization rate of heat energy is increased.
2.Compared with the resistance heating, the electromagnetic heater directly acts on the feed tube heating, reducing the heat loss of heat transfer.
3.Compared with resistance heating, the heating speed of electromagnetic heater is more than a quarter faster, reducing the heating time.
4.Compared with resistance heating, the heating speed of electromagnetic heater is fast, the production efficiency is improved, so that the motor is in the saturation state, so that it reduces the power loss caused by high power and low demand.

classification
(1) Classification according to plastination method
1.Plunger type plastic injection molding machine
Its mixing is very poor, plasticizing is not good, to add a diversion shuttle device. It is rarely used.
2.Reciprocating screw plastic injection molding machine;Depending on screw plasticization and injection, mixing and plasticization are very good, the most used.
3.Screw -- plunger type plastic injection molding machine depends on the screw for plasticizing and depends on the plunger for injection, the two processes are separate.
(2) According to the mode of clamping classification
1.Mechanical
2.Hydraulic
3.Hydraulic - mechanical

Vertical injection molding machine
1.Injection devices and mould locking devices are always available at the same vertical center line, with the mould opening and closing along the upper and lower directions. Its floor area is only about half of the horizontal machine, therefore, converted into floor area of production is about two times.
2. Easy to achieve insert molding. Because the surface of the mold is facing up, the insert can be easily placed and positioned. If the lower template is fixed and the upper template is movable, and the belt conveying device is combined with the mechanical palm, the automatic insert molding can be easily realized.
3.The weight of the mold is supported by the horizontal template for the up and down opening and closing action. There will be no forward fall caused by the gravity of the mold of the horizontal machine, which makes the template unable to open and close. Facilitates durability and maintains precision of machinery and molds.
4. Through the simple manipulator can be removed from each plastic cavity, is conducive to precision molding.
5. The general mold locking device around the open, easy to configure all kinds of automatic devices, suitable for complex, exquisite products automatic molding.
6. Pull belt conveying device is easy to realize the middle installation of string mold, easy to realize automatic molding production.
7. Easy to ensure the fluidity of resin in the mold and mold temperature distribution consistency.
8. Equipped with rotating table, moving table and tilt table and other forms, easy to achieve embedded molding, mold combination molding.
9. Small batch trial production, the mold structure is simple, low cost, and easy to unload.
10. Withstood the test of many earthquakes, vertical machine because of the low center of gravity, relative horizontal machine better earthquake resistance.
Horizontal injection molding machine
1.Even for the mainframe, there is no height restriction for the workshop due to its low fuselage.
2.The product can fall automatically, do not need to use the manipulator can also achieve automatic molding.
3. Due to the low fuselage, convenient feeding, easy maintenance.
4.The mold shall be installed by crane.
5.Under the arrangement of multiple sets, the molding products are easy to be collected and packaged by the conveyor belt.
Angle injection molding machine
The axis of the injection screw of the Angle injection molding machine and the motion axis of the mould clamping mechanism template are perpendicular to each other, and their advantages and disadvantages are between the vertical and horizontal. Because of its injection direction and mold parting surface in the same plane, so the Angle injection molding machine is suitable for the opening of the side gate of the asymmetric geometry of the mold or molding center is not allowed to leave the gate trace products.
